Switzerland returned three ancient Mesopotamian artifacts (1,700-2,800 years old) to Iraq, marking the most significant restitution since 2005. The items, including a partial statue and two reliefs, were seized during a criminal procedure in Geneva and their accused owner was convicted for document forgery and violating the Cultural Property Transfer Act. Switzerland and Iraq are parties to a UNESCO convention to protect cultural heritage by banning and preventing the illegal trade of cultural property.
